Starts at 11am at Sutton House, 2-4 Homerton High Street. Walk distance 2 miles; time (including numerous stops) about 2-2½ hours 

Julia Lafferty and Laurie Elks will lead a walk which starts in Homerton High Street – Hackney’s smartest street 500 years ago – and proceeds up Chatsworth Road, which is rapidly becoming Hackney’s coolest neighbourhood.

The walk starts at Sutton House and we will take a tour up St Barnabas Church Tower and look at Hackney Hospital, once the parish workhouse, and the excellent Victorian pubs of Homerton High Street.

Going up to Chatsworth Road we will take in the exquisite former library building which is now Chats Palace, the former cinema which has been beautifully restored as the Eat 17 restaurant, see the former public lavatory which is now a café and detour up side streets to see a former music hall, an art deco pub and a Victorian vicarage.  We will go on to the Lea Bridge Conservation Area including the Old School House in Lea Bridge Road and the Princess of Wales pub beside the River Lea where the walk will end.
